KEY FACTORS

Factors that Affect Meridian Car Shipping Costs

Distance

Meridian's location in southwestern Idaho means shipping distances vary significantly depending on your destination. Longer routes to coastal states or the Northeast will cost more due to increased fuel, driver time, and wear-and-tear, while regional moves within the Pacific Northwest tend to be more affordable. Season

Idaho winters (November through March) can increase shipping costs due to snow and ice on regional highways, which may require specialized equipment or longer transit times. Summer months see higher demand for car shipping nationwide, potentially raising prices during peak moving season. Route

Shipping to or from Meridian typically routes through I-84, which connects to major corridors heading east toward Salt Lake City or west toward Portland and Seattle. The quality of these interstate connections generally keeps Meridian competitive on pricing, though winter weather on mountain passes can occasionally affect routing and timelines. Vehicle Type

Larger vehicles like trucks, SUVs, and full-size sedans cost more to ship than compact cars due to weight, space requirements, and fuel consumption. Luxury, classic, or specialty vehicles may require enclosed transport, which adds to the base cost but protects your investment. Tips & Tricks for Saving on Vehicle Shipping

1

Off Season Savings

Late spring through early summer (May-June) offers the lowest rates for Meridian shipments, as demand drops after the busy winter moving season and before peak summer travel. Idaho's harsh winters make fall and winter the premium seasons, so booking your transport for late spring can save 15-25% compared to winter rates when carriers compete heavily for limited Meridian routes.

2

Flexible pickup & delivery

If you can accept a 5-10 day delivery window instead of a fixed date, carriers can batch your vehicle with others heading through I-84 toward or from Meridian, reducing their deadhead miles and passing savings to you. 3

Hub city advantages

Meridian's position on I-84 between Boise and the Oregon border makes it a natural routing point for westbound and eastbound traffic, which increases carrier availability and competition—driving prices down compared to more remote Idaho locations. 4

Weather considerations

Winter shipping to/from Meridian (November-March) costs more due to snow and ice hazards on I-84, so planning your transport for late spring or early fall avoids weather premiums and potential delays. If you must ship during Idaho's winter months, book at least 3 weeks early to secure a carrier comfortable with winter conditions and budget extra time for weather-related holds.

5

Booking in advance

Booking 2-3 weeks ahead for Meridian shipments gives carriers time to plan routes and fill available trailer space, resulting in better rates than last-minute bookings which often require premium pricing. Early booking also increases your choice of carriers and reduces the risk of delays during Idaho's unpredictable spring weather or peak summer travel season.

6

Open carrier transport

Shipping your vehicle on an open trailer instead of an enclosed carrier saves 20-35% on Meridian routes, since open transport is the industry standard for this region and carriers operate frequent open-trailer circuits through the I-84 corridor. Reserve enclosed transport only if your vehicle is luxury, classic, or requires weather protection—otherwise, open trailers are safe, reliable, and significantly cheaper.

Moving Insights

Things to Know About Moving to/from Meridian

Professional auto transport service for Meridian moves

When shipping a vehicle to or from Meridian, Idaho, understanding state registration requirements is essential. Idaho requires all vehicles to be registered with the Department of Motor Vehicles, and new residents have 90 days to obtain an Idaho title and registration after establishing residency [DMV]. The registration process requires proof of ownership, identification, and proof of insurance—minimum liability coverage of 25/50/15 (bodily injury and property damage limits) [DMV]. Before arranging auto transport to Meridian, ensure you have the necessary documents ready, as detailed in our guide on what documents you need to ship a car.



Meridian-specific considerations include parking regulations in downtown areas and residential zones, which require compliance with city ordinances [City Website]. Idaho doesn't require emission testing statewide, making car shipping simpler than many states. However, winter preparation is critical for Meridian residents—the region experiences significant snowfall, making winter tires or chains essential from November through March [Idaho Transportation Department]. Window tinting is permitted but must allow at least 35% light transmission on side windows [DMV]. Vehicle frame height modifications must comply with Idaho's 13-foot maximum height restriction for standard roads [DMV]. Car Shipping 101

How Auto Transport Works

Car shipping in Meridian, ID is a straightforward process when you work with the right partner. Whether you're moving to California, Texas, Florida, or anywhere else, understanding how auto transport works helps you feel confident about your decision. At its core, car shipping involves two key players: brokers and carriers. Brokers like Sakaem Logistics connect you with licensed carriers who actually transport your vehicle. This distinction matters because reputable brokers vet their carriers carefully, ensuring they have proper FMCSA licensing, insurance coverage, and positive reviews.



Here's how the car shipping process works from start to finish. First, you'll call a broker like Sakaem Logistics to get a quote for your auto transport needs. The broker will ask about your vehicle type, pickup location, and destination. Next, the broker finds a qualified carrier who accepts your shipment. This is where choosing a reputable broker makes all the difference—they'll match you with carriers that have strong track records and proper insurance. Once a carrier is assigned, they'll contact you to schedule a pickup time. Before pickup day arrives, prepare your vehicle by clearing out all personal items and ensuring it has about a quarter tank of gas. The carrier will then pick up your car and transport it to your destination. Finally, you'll pay the broker or carrier at the time of pickup or delivery, depending on your agreement.



A few important details about the transport process will help ensure smooth shipping. Your vehicle must be in running condition and able to roll onto the transport trailer. If you're shipping a high-end or luxury vehicle, request an enclosed trailer for added protection. Always empty your car completely before the carrier arrives—personal items aren't covered during transport. Having about a quarter tank of gas ensures your vehicle can be driven on and off the trailer safely.
